What is an internship Sr Drupal developer?

An Internship Sr Drupal Developer is an intern-level role focused on assisting with the development, customization, and maintenance of websites using the Drupal content management system. Despite the 'Sr' (Senior) in the title, this position typically offers practical experience for students or recent graduates who have some prior exposure to Drupal and web development. Responsibilities often include coding, troubleshooting, updating modules, and collaborating with other developers under the guidance of senior staff. This internship helps individuals gain real-world experience and deepen their understanding of Drupal's architecture and best practices.

How does an internship Sr Drupal developer typically collaborate with other team members during a project?

As an Internship Sr Drupal Developer, you'll frequently work alongside front-end developers, designers, project managers, and QA testers to deliver robust Drupal-based solutions. Collaboration often involves participating in daily standups, code reviews, and sprint planning to ensure alignment on project goals and timelines. You may be responsible for mentoring junior interns or developers, sharing best practices, and helping troubleshoot complex Drupal-related issues. This collaborative, agile environment supports both technical growth and a deeper understanding of the full software development lifecycle.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an internship Sr Drupal developer?

To thrive as an Internship Sr Drupal Developer, you need strong PHP programming skills, experience with Drupal CMS, and a foundational understanding of web development principles, often supported by relevant coursework or certifications. Familiarity with tools like Composer, Drush, Git, and development environments such as LAMP or Docker is typically expected. Problem-solving, collaboration, and attention to detail are crucial soft skills for adapting to dynamic projects and working within development teams. These skills and qualities ensure the delivery of robust, scalable Drupal solutions and smooth integration within professional workflows.
